Connections for the Homeless: Transforming Lives, One Step at a Time
Connections for the Homeless is a vital organization dedicated to empowering individuals and families experiencing homelessness in the Evanston area. At the heart of their work is the Margarita Inn, a year-round transitional housing program offering a safe and supportive environment for those working toward stability. Residents at the Margarita Inn receive not only shelter but access to case management, job training, and emotional support to rebuild their lives.
Beyond transitional housing, Connections operates a drop-in shelter that serves as a critical lifeline for individuals without permanent homes. Here, guests can find a safe place to rest during the day, access basic hygiene facilities, and connect with a caring community.
Connections also provides daily meals, ensuring that no one goes hungry. Hot, nutritious meals are served to residents and drop-in guests, often prepared and donated by volunteers.
The organization meets other essential needs, too, by offering clothing and personal supplies. These donations give individuals the dignity and comfort of proper attire, especially during harsh winter months.
With additional services like housing placement, employment assistance, and health resources, Connections for the Homeless is more than a shelter—it’s a comprehensive support network helping people regain stability and hope. Their mission truly transforms lives, one connection at a time.
Volunteer opportunities at Connections for the Homeless include preparing and serving meals, organizing clothing donations, assisting at the drop-in shelter, and supporting residents at the Margarita Inn, all while making a meaningful impact in the fight against homelessness.
